How to get a police certificate - El Salvador
If you need to give your fingerprints for a police certificate, this isn’t the same as giving your biometrics (fingerprints and photo) for an application.
Name of the documents you need
- Constancia de Antecedentes Penales (also known as Solvencia de Antecedentes Penales)
-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ales (also known as Solvencia de Antecedentes Policiales)

How to apply
If you are a citizen of El Salvador
Apply in person or through an authorized third party for a Constancia de Antecedentes Penales through the Dirección General de Centros Penales in San Salvador (see Contact information for the complete addresses) or apply online.
Apply for a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ales online or in person through the Dirección General de la Policía Nacional Civil y de Readaptación(see Contact Information for the complete address).
Online applications shall be finalized and sent via email within 5 business days, but there may be exceptions.
If you are not a citizen of El Salvador
If you live in El Salvador
Apply for a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ales online or in person through the Dirección General de la Policía Nacional Civil (see Contact Information for the complete address).
Apply for the Antecedentes Penales online or in person or through an authorized third party for the Constancia de Antecedentes Penales at the Dirección General de Centros Penales y de Readaptación in San Salvador (see Contact Information for the complete address).
If you live outside of El Salvador
Apply for a Constancia de Antecedentes Penales and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ales in person at your nearest consulate of El Salvador.
Please note: In person services outside of El Salvador to obtain the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ales can take two to three months, as the consulate sends the request to Foreign Affairs of El Salvador by diplomatic bag, and they will forward it to the police station, where the background is consulted. When the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ales is processed, it will be returned using the same procedure.
Documents you need
El Salvador nationals and residents:
- the original and a photocopy of your valid Documento Único de Identificación (DUI) or your valid passport
- the applicable fees
Foreign residents:
- the original and a photocopy of your passport
- two frontal pictures and two pictures of your right side
- the proper completed form (available at the consulate)
- a letter stating why you require a police certificate (i.e., for immigration purposes)
- the applicable fees
Special considerations
The Unit of Police Background Check reserves the right to not issue the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ales to people who were found to have criminal records and/or have not cleared their legal situation.
In the event of an inconvenience obtaining the Constancia de Antecedentes Policiales, you may dial the toll-free number +1 888 301 1130 of the virtual consulate. You may contact your nearest consulate of El Salvador as well.
